SB570 by Bettencourt (Relating to an attendance policy adopted by public schools to prevent truancy.), As Engrossed

No significant fiscal implication to the State is anticipated.

It is assumed that any costs associated with the bill could be absorbed using existing resources.

Local Government Impact

It is assumed that school districts and open-enrollment charter schools would be required to adopt and implement an attendance policy that adheres to the requirements of the Act; however, no significant fiscal implication to units of local government is anticipated.
